Abstract


This bridge is a part of Motorway A614 constituting the beit road around the city of Nottingham and is located at the west of the city centre. The project includes the bridge on the river Trent and link roads at both river banks. These structures together with phase I of the Clifton bridge, completed in 1958, provide 3 lanes of traffic in each direction, permitting an easy crossing of the river and connecting the city center, the industrial section in the North bank and the residential sections in the South bank, at the same time as linking the system with the M-1 Motorway. The design is by R. Travers Morgan & Partners and w/as built by Peter Lind & Co Ltd for the Secretary of State.
